Interesting Facts About Alexa

  1. Alexa is an artificial intelligence-powered virtual assistant technology developed by Amazon.
  2. Alexa supports different operating systems, like Fire OS, iOS, and Android.
  3. Most devices with Alexa allow users to activate the device using a wake-word (such as Alexa or Amazon).
  4. As of November 2018, Amazon had more than 10,000 employees working on Alexa and related products.
  5. In 2019, Amazon has sold more than 100 million devices with its Alexa smart assistant built-in.
  6. You can build different things with Alexa. Like, Alexa Skills, Alexa Devices, Enterprise Solutions.
  7. Alexa is a project inspired by Star Trek. Alexa was inspired by the computer voice and conversational system onboard the Starship Enterprise in science fiction TV series and movies.
  8. This artificial intelligence-powered virtual assistant was named Alexa because it has a hard consonant with the X, which helps it be recognized with higher precision.
  9. In June 2015, Amazon announced the Alexa Fund, a program that would invest in companies making voice control skills and technologies.
  10. Since 2015, the Alexa Fund has invested in companies that are innovating in AI, voice technology, frontier tech, robotics, etc.
  11. The Alexa Fund provides up to $200 million in venture capital funding to fuel voice technology innovation. Amazon believes experiences designed around the human voice will fundamentally improve the way people use technology.
  12. In 2018, Amazon partnered with Lennar to include the voice-activated technology in all their new homes, to create “Experience Centers” in their model homes that will allow customers to interact with the suite of Amazon devices — including Dash buttons, Alexa, and Echo — in a more natural living environment.
  13. Amazon’s Alexa is capable of voice interaction, music playback, making to-do lists, setting alarms, streaming podcasts, playing audiobooks, and providing weather, traffic, sports, and news. 
  14. Alexa also possesses the capability of controlling several smart devices using itself as a home automation system.
  15. The Alexa capabilities can be extended by installing “Alexa Skills”. It’s like an addon.
  16. Alexa Skills are like apps for Alexa and provide a new channel for your content and services.
  17. Alexa Skills let customers use their voices to perform everyday tasks like checking the news, listening to music, playing a game, and more.
  18. The Alexa Skills Kit (ASK) provides self-service APIs and tools that you can use to build Alexa skills.

  27. When Amazon was testing what would eventually become Alexa, some workers and even the company’s CEO, Jeff Bezos, were frustrated with its performance, according to a new book about the business.
  28. Bezos tested an Alexa-powered device – a project referred to as the “Doppler” – at his home in Seattle. “In pique of frustration over its lack of comprehension, he told Alexa to go ‘shoot yourself in the head,'” Brad Stone wrote in his book “Amazon Unbound: Jeff Bezos and the Invention of a Global Empire” Source
